According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the national average salary for registered nurses stands at approximately $37.24 per hour and $77,600 annually, while New York State averages come in higher at around $42.01 per hour and $87,551 annually. Here in our town, NurseRecruiter estimates that the average salary range for nurses is between $35.00 to $40.00 per hour, translating to about $72,800 to $83,200 annually. This is competitive for a region that’s near larger urban centers like Buffalo, where job opportunities and salaries can be noticeably higher.

The job market for nursing in Springville is both stable and promising, driven by a healthcare infrastructure with significant demand. We currently have an estimated workforce of around 250 nurses, contributing to the healthcare of our 4,200 residents. The area is forecasted to require approximately 30% more nurses within the next five years, considering factors such as upcoming retirements and local population growth. Travel nursing has seen a steady demand, particularly during peak tourist seasons from late spring to early fall, as our region's charm draws visitors, increasing the need for nursing professionals. Per diem opportunities are also flourishing, with many regional facilities such as the Springville Memorial Hospital and various outpatient clinics actively seeking flexible staff.
